How to Practice the Digital Pause Daily

Incorporating a digital pause into your daily routine can significantly enhance your overall mindfulness and presence in the digital space. Here are actionable steps to help you cultivate this practice effectively.

First, establish set reminders throughout your day. Whether it’s through alarms on your phone or sticky notes on your computer screen, gentle nudges can remind you to take a moment to breathe and reflect. Aim for intervals that suit your schedule, such as every hour or after completing certain tasks. This small yet powerful habit encourages an intentional break from the digital world, allowing for a clearer perspective.

Next, create dedicated moments for reflection before responding to messages or engaging with posts. This is particularly important in the fast-paced environment of social media. Before you type a response or click "send," pause for a few seconds to consider your thoughts and emotions. Ask yourself if your response aligns with your values and goals. This process encourages thoughtful engagement rather than impulsive reactions, enhancing digital mindfulness.

Additionally, implement mindfulness exercises that can elevate your awareness each time you interact with technology. For instance, practice deep breathing for a minute before starting your device. As you breathe, focus on the sensations in your body and the environment around you. This practice helps ground you, creating a sense of calm that can influence your digital interactions positively.

Finally, review your device usage at the end of each day. Consider journaling about your experience and any feelings that arose during your digital engagements. Reflecting on your interactions can provide insight into patterns you may wish to change, further guiding your journey toward digital mindfulness.
